#ifdef GIT_WIN32
static inline time_t filetime_to_time_t(const FILETIME *ft)
{
long long winTime = ((long long)ft->dwHighDateTime << 32) + ft->dwLowDateTime;
winTime -= 116444736000000000LL; /* Windows to Unix Epoch conversion */
winTime /= 10000000; /* Nano to seconds resolution */
return (time_t)winTime;
}
static int do_lstat(const char *file_name, struct stat *buf)
{
WIN32_FILE_ATTRIBUTE_DATA fdata;
if (GetFileAttributesExA(file_name, GetFileExInfoStandard, &fdata)) {
int fMode = S_IREAD;
if (fdata.dwFileAttributes & FILE_ATTRIBUTE_DIRECTORY)
fMode |= S_IFDIR;
else
fMode |= S_IFREG;
if (!(fdata.dwFileAttributes & FILE_ATTRIBUTE_READONLY))
fMode |= S_IWRITE;
if (fdata.dwFileAttributes & FILE_ATTRIBUTE_REPARSE_POINT)
fMode |= _S_IFLNK;
buf->st_ino = 0;
buf->st_gid = 0;
buf->st_uid = 0;
buf->st_nlink = 1;
buf->st_mode = fMode;
buf->st_size = fdata.nFileSizeLow; /* Can't use nFileSizeHigh, since it's not a stat64 */
buf->st_dev = buf->st_rdev = (_getdrive() - 1);
buf->st_atime = filetime_to_time_t(&(fdata.ftLastAccessTime));
buf->st_mtime = filetime_to_time_t(&(fdata.ftLastWriteTime));
buf->st_ctime = filetime_to_time_t(&(fdata.ftCreationTime));
return GIT_SUCCESS;
}
switch (GetLastError()) {
case ERROR_ACCESS_DENIED:
case ERROR_SHARING_VIOLATION:
case ERROR_LOCK_VIOLATION:
case ERROR_SHARING_BUFFER_EXCEEDED:
return GIT_EOSERR;
case ERROR_BUFFER_OVERFLOW:
case ERROR_NOT_ENOUGH_MEMORY:
return GIT_ENOMEM;
default:
return GIT_EINVALIDPATH;
}
}
int gitfo_lstat__w32(const char *file_name, struct stat *buf)
{
int namelen, error;
char alt_name[GIT_PATH_MAX];
if ((error = do_lstat(file_name, buf)) == GIT_SUCCESS)
return GIT_SUCCESS;
/* if file_name ended in a '/', Windows returned ENOENT;
* try again without trailing slashes
*/
if (error != GIT_EINVALIDPATH)
return git__throw(GIT_EOSERR, "Failed to lstat file");
namelen = strlen(file_name);
if (namelen && file_name[namelen-1] != '/')
return git__throw(GIT_EOSERR, "Failed to lstat file");
while (namelen && file_name[namelen-1] == '/')
--namelen;
if (!namelen || namelen >= GIT_PATH_MAX)
return git__throw(GIT_ENOMEM, "Failed to lstat file");
memcpy(alt_name, file_name, namelen);
alt_name[namelen] = 0;
return do_lstat(alt_name, buf);
}
int gitfo_readlink__w32(const char *link, char *target, size_t target_len)
{
HANDLE hFile;
DWORD dwRet;
hFile = CreateFile(link, // file to open
GENERIC_READ, // open for reading
FILE_SHARE_READ, // share for reading
NULL, // default security
OPEN_EXISTING, // existing file only
FILE_FLAG_BACKUP_SEMANTICS, // normal file
NULL); // no attr. template
if (hFile == INVALID_HANDLE_VALUE)
return GIT_EOSERR;
dwRet = GetFinalPathNameByHandleA(hFile, target, target_len, VOLUME_NAME_DOS);
if (dwRet >= target_len)
return GIT_ENOMEM;
CloseHandle(hFile);
if (dwRet > 4) {
/* Skip first 4 characters if they are "\\?\" */
if (target[0] == '\\' && target[1] == '\\' && target[2] == '?' && target[3] == '\\') {
char tmp[MAXPATHLEN];
unsigned int offset = 4;
dwRet -= 4;
/* \??\UNC\ */
if (dwRet > 7 && target[4] == 'U' && target[5] == 'N' && target[6] == 'C') {
offset += 2;
dwRet -= 2;
target[offset] = '\\';
}
memcpy(tmp, target + offset, dwRet);
memcpy(target, tmp, dwRet);
}
}
target[dwRet] = '\0';
return dwRet;
}
#endif
